Output df8bc39d6e6aa7abd384e667f8da12488d25a65fb32f4d5b5958aaffe6d5fc81:0

value
177960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c0cfab3797366f335a31b485912590b55bd9d2 OP_EQUAL
address
3FhzHejAwk4JNNzpgiSkSRwRfWaZoU5vGB
transaction
df8bc39d6e6aa7abd384e667f8da12488d25a65fb32f4d5b5958aaffe6d5fc81
confirmations
157638
spent
true